Maxar is looking for a Sr Manager to join our Analytics and Solutions division and lead the Analytics Development team. This team produces capabilities that solve customer problems in innovative ways and unlock new markets for geospatial insights. Analytics Development will evaluate and develop emerging methods and disruptive technologies, characterizing suitability for adoption and pathways for implementation and eventual transition to production. The position can be performed remotely within the United States; though the team is based in Westminster, CO.

In this role, the Manager will report to the Sr Director of Analytics and Solutions and have the support of a Tech Lead, to help guide them to execute requests from a wide variety of customers, promote career progression, and to coordinate workflows with the adjacent Analytics Engineering and Applied Analytics teams. The manager is expected to respond tactfully to Product and Engineering requirements, guided by a deep understanding of emerging machine learning, data science, electro optics, and unstructured data analysis. The position requires fundamental experience in emerging machine learning technologies, such as Transformers, LLMs, and Computer Vision, and backend capabilities that help scale, accelerate, and optimize user access to data and analytics workflows.

We use quick iteration and regular feedback cycles to rapidly build sensemaking capabilities for customers, both internal and external, to provide Analytics & Solutions, backed with a sophisticated data architecture, that accelerate the flow of work from experimentation to development to production across Machine Learning, Data Science, and Research Science workflows.

Requirements/Skills

Our team's minimum requirements for this position:

  • Must be a U.S. Person.

  • Master's degree in a related field, (e.g., Computer Science, Mechanical or Electrical Engineering, Systems Engineering, Applied Math, etc.) and 5-10 years of professional experience.

  • At least 2 years of people management.

  • Experience with software development and algorithm design with Python, including Object Oriented Programming methodologies.

  • Experience bringing research code into a production software environment.

  • Recent experience with the following technologies:

  • Modern modeling techniques such as Transformers, LLMs, YOLO, etc.

  • Cloud technologies like AWS or Azure, with a focus on services like RDS, EKS, and S3/ECR,

  • Managed infrastructure like Kubernetes & Docker,

  • GitHub, GitLab, BitBucket, or any other Git tools,

  • Experience working with and engineering geospatial datasets.

Preferred qualifications:

  • Ph.D. in a related field, (e.g., Computer Science, Mechanical or Electrical Engineering, Systems Engineering, Applied Math, etc.) and 8 years of professional experience.

  • Experience in emerging modeling techniques (Foundational Models, LLMs, YOLOV8, Graph Ontologies, etc)

  • Experience using Jira for project management and Aha! for product requirements tracking.

  • Experience using machine learning development frameworks and machine learning operations technologies, such as PyTorch and/or Tensorflow and knowledge of utilizing platforms built on top of Terraform with Helm, or other infrastructure-as-code tools.

  • Ability to work independently and collaboratively with remote and/or geographically distributed teams.
